Before we get started, it's really important to understand the deployment lifecycle. The deployment process typically consists of several stages like development, testing, staging, production, and maintenance. During the development phase, the application is created and tested locally. Next, it moves to the testing environment where it undergoes another round of testing to make sure that everything works as expected. Once tested, it is deployed to a staging environment, which typically is an environment as close as possible to the production environment. Finally, the app is released to the production environment where it serves real users. Maintenance is not just another step, but rather a process of ongoing updates and improvements. But what are some of the deployment challenges? Deploying an application comes with its own set of challenges. One of the biggest issues is compatibility. Your app might behave differently depending on the environment it's deployed in. Due to differences in operating systems, middleware and hardware configurations. To tackle this issue, make sure that you test your app extensively in different environments. You might also want to consider using Docker for containerization, which can help ensure consistency across different setups. We are going to talk about Docker in the upcoming chapters. Security is also a big deal when it comes to the apps. You need to protect your application from potential attacks to prevent the data breaches and meet security standards. This means that you need to check for vulnerabilities, you need to write secure code, and also use encryption to protect sensitive information. Performance issues can really slow down your app and frustrate users. These problems come from inefficient code, slow database queries, or even not enough resources. To keep your app up and running and also running smoothly, you'll need to fine tune performance, do load testing, and optimize both your code and database queries. As your app grows, you'll need to handle more users and more data. The key here is to maintain performance under heavy loads and distribute workloads effectively. You can do this by adding more servers, so horizontal scaling, upgrading existing servers, so vertical scaling, and using cloud services for auto scaling to keep up with the growth. Last but not least, configuration management is super important for keeping things consistent across different environments like development, testing, staging, and production. Using a configuration management tool helps you manage and maintain environment specific configuration files, and version control for these configurations ensures that everything stays reliable and consistent during deployments.
